If a client expresses discontentment, listen thoroughly to their feedback, apologize if essential, and deal california web design firms solutions that align with their vision while staying within the task's scope.
Practice active listening techniques-- repeat back what you have actually heard-- and ask clarifying questions when essential to make sure good understanding between you and your client.
Yes! Agreements secure both parties by plainly detailing expectations concerning payment terms, deadlines, scope of work, and modification processes.
Regular check-ins depend on the project's timeline but go for a minimum of bi-weekly updates during larger projects unless otherwise agreed upon.
Be proactive-- contact your client as quickly as possible to explain the scenario and propose a brand-new timeline based on genuine factors rather than waiting till the last minute.
